Pages - Menu

2013年11月12日火曜日

[git] 各種戻し方

■一つのファイルの編集した後で、前回コミットしたところまで、修正内容を戻したいファイルがある場合

git checkout file_path


■ファイルの更新履歴を全て削除したい時(gitの管理下から外す時)

#ディレクトリごと
git rm --cached -r dir/
#ファイルだけ
git rm --cached file_path


■更新履歴がある場合、.gitignoreでignore出来ません。この場合、「ファイルの更新履歴を全て削除」してください。やり方は上記。

0 件のコメント:

コメントを投稿